Default Hobby City FTL26

18 hours running. 30 - 1 mineral oil. 93 Octane fuel. NGK BPMR6F Plug (this made a very noticable improvement). 16X8 G-Sonic. 4.8v Ignition Battery.

Max 8250 Min 2100

I have recently stripped this engine to investigate some end float. This turned out to be movement of the rear bearing caused by electric starting. This could be easily shimmed out, but I chose to reseat the bearing (interference fit - heat the casing) and hand start in future. Now that I am confident at hand starting (big glove), all is well. I don't use choke as I can easily jam a thumb up the intake. As soon as fuel is evident in the intake, a couple of flicks starts it.

I was very impressed by the quality of castings and componants of this engine. I see no reason why it should not give years of service.

Default Re: Real world RPM

What canister and/or pipe do you run? power seems to be in the pitts type muffler range
If a prop has less than half the diameter in pitch, it becomes less effective. Instead of choosing forrpm, you might try to load the engine and prop a bit more, like a 23x10 or 22x10 or even 22x12. he latter will give better spool-up, but needs lower idle for landing.
